备战2012数学应考能力大提升17.1.docVIP

  • 0
  • 0
  • 约小于1千字
  • 约 5页
  • 2018-05-07 发布于福建
  • 举报
典型例题 例1 写出找出1至1 000内7的倍数的一个算法. 解答:算法1: S1 令A=0; S2 将A不断增加1,每加一次,就将A除以7,若余数为0,则找 到了一个7的倍数,将其输出; S3 反复执行第二步,直到A=1 000结束. 算法2: S1 令k=1; S2 输出k·7的值; S3 将k的值增加1,若k·7的值小于1 000,则返回S2,否则结 束. 算法3: S1 令x=7; S2 输出x的值; S3 将x的值增加7,若没有超过1 000,则返回S2,否则结束. 例2 设计算法求的值,并画出程序框图。 思路解析:(1)这是一个累加求和问题,共99项相加; (2)设计一个计数变量,一个累加变量,用循环结构实现这一算法。 解答:算法如下: 第一步:令S=0, 第二步:若成立,则执行第三步; 否则,输出S,结束算法; 第三步: 第四步:,返回第二步。 程序框图: 方法一:当型循环程序框图: 方法二:直到型循环程序框图: 注:利用循环结构表示算法,一定要先确定是利用当型循环结构,还是直到型循环结构;第二要选择准确的表示累计的变量;第三要注意在哪一步开始循环。 创新题型 1. 修订后的《中华人民共和国个人所得税》法规定,公民全月工资、薪金所得税的起征点为1600

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档